Output d12895dbab9c003715e264ccfd3d2d7ffe63081fb0e42fcee64b918f57e3ef0a:1

value
1756922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ff1b366a9beb79ab1e6c78fa91eb584565bdf15f OP_EQUAL
address
3QwtqDs9ajqHAgeaJmPWfit2nwWW3Zyipq
transaction
d12895dbab9c003715e264ccfd3d2d7ffe63081fb0e42fcee64b918f57e3ef0a
spent
true